Rydberg transitions in Be‐like Si XI

2008 
Measurements of Δn=1 Rydberg transition wavelengths for Be‐like Si XI are presented for 1s22s9l’←1s22s10l and 1s22s8l’←1s22s9l. The large polarizability of the open core 1s22s and configuration interaction with nearby 1s22pnl states yield observable 1‐structure that is compared with the polarization model, Multi Configurational Dirac‐Fock (MCDF) and Many Body Perturbation Theory (MBPT) calculations. We discussed the high‐1 structure of the n=9–10 transition previously in relation to plasma observations. The first application of MBPT calculations to Be‐like Rydberg states was reported with our measurement of the 7I–8K transition in S XIII.
